Fatal Bazooka was a french parodic group of rap composed of Michaël Youn, Vincent Desagnat and Benjamin Morgaine. The group found its origin in 2002 in a sketch of Morning Live, that the members presented at the time. It is in particular known for singles "Fous ta cagoule" (2006), "Mauvaise foi nocturne", "J'aime trop ton boule", "Trankillement" and "Parle à ma main" (2007). Fatal Bazooka is also the name of the fictitious singer of the group (played by Michaël Youn). Read more on Last.fm
